Remington R17 Ball-Pull Switchblade
Posted: Sat Mar 10, 2012 5:03 pm
I recently purchased a Rem R17 and it has white plastic handles and they show some stress
near the pins. I intend to send this to MM for re-handle in Marigold Bone but wanted to ask
some of you Rem guys about the script on the knife. It reads 'OVER THE LINE IN 40'.
From a little poking around it looks like this may be a reference to WWII ?? Maybe the Maginot
or Siegfried Lines....I am leaning toward Siegfried. I did also read that the UK had a 1935-1940
New Works Programme that had to do with transportation lines ?? I guess it helps to date the
knife if nothing else. Help would be appreciated, trying to figure out if I should remove the
stock handles or if they add value.
Added a poor pic......but it does say "Over the Line in '40"
